Feature-by-feature
ADHD is an experimental, open-source method that spawns N parallel coding branches under distinct cognitive frames (e.g., regulator, speedrunner, biology) with no cross-branch context sharing during divergence, forcing structurally different ideas. It enforces a mechanical generator-critic separation: the generator system prompt forbids evaluation, and a single critic pass scores, clusters, and deepens only top-K survivors. This prevents premature convergence and is evaluated on six open-ended engineering problems. It supports Claude and Codex Agent SDK but has no integrations beyond that.
Cognition AI's Devin, on the other hand, is a full autonomous software engineer for enterprise production code. It handles multi-step tasks end-to-end: planning, coding, testing, PR creation, and bug triage. Key features include FrontierCode evaluation for merge-worthiness, Auto-Triage (automated bug monitoring and fix PRs), native Windows VM and Android emulator support, and the Devin Desktop (Windsurf IDE + Devin Cloud + Agent Command Center). Devin also offers a Security Swarm for vulnerability find-and-fix, a Fusion architecture for 35% lower cost, and session persistence across runs. It integrates deeply with GitHub, Slack, Jira, Linear, Datadog, and more—something ADHD completely lacks.
ADHD prioritizes divergent thinking for creative exploration; Devin prioritizes reliable, reproducible, production-ready output. They serve fundamentally different needs.
Pricing compared
ADHD is free and open-source. There are no paid tiers, usage limits, or vendor lock-in. However, it requires you to have access to Claude or Codex Agent SDK (which have their own usage costs). As a research method, there's no support or guarantee.
Cognition AI uses a freemium model with enterprise pricing that is not publicly disclosed. Given its target audience (Fortune 500 companies like Mercedes-Benz), it is likely priced per seat or per usage at a premium. Notable: the Fusion architecture claims 35% lower cost (latest news: 'Fable 5 with Fusion architecture achieves lower cost and higher score than Opus 4.8'), but you are still paying for Devin. The AI Productivity Guarantee (up to $10M) provides a safety net for large enterprises. For individual developers or small teams, ADHD costs nothing; for enterprise teams, Devin's pricing is opaque but backed by a guarantee.
Who should pick which
- Solo founder exploring creative solutionsPick: adhd
ADHD's free, open-source method helps generate diverse ideas for fuzzy, open-ended engineering problems without upfront cost.
- Enterprise engineering team with production codebasePick: Cognition AI
Devin's autonomous planning, coding, PR creation, and bug triage, plus FedRAMP compliance, handle enterprise-scale needs.
- Researcher studying premature convergence in LLMsPick: adhd
ADHD's explicit generator-critic separation and cognitive frames are ideal for academic exploration of divergent ideation.
- DevOps team managing bug triagePick: Cognition AI
Auto-Triage with automated bug monitoring and fix PRs reduces manual incident response.
- Cross-platform developer (Windows, Android)Pick: Cognition AI
Native Windows VM and Android emulator support let Devin build and test natively for those platforms.

Can ADHD be used with any LLM, or is it limited to Claude and Codex Agent SDK?
ADHD is designed to work with Claude and Codex Agent SDK, as stated in its features. It may work with others but is not officially supported.
Does Cognition AI's Devin have a free tier?
Cognition AI uses a freemium model, but the free tier's exact limits are not publicly detailed. The enterprise plan is for large teams.
What cognitive frames does ADHD include?
ADHD includes 15 cognitive frames such as regulator, speedrunner, biology, and $0 budget, among others.
Is the ADHD method peer-reviewed?
It is a preprint (v0.1) and not yet peer-reviewed; it is experimental and open-source.
How does Devin's AI Productivity Guarantee work?
The guarantee promises up to $10M in measurable value; specific terms are likely detailed in enterprise contracts.
Can ADHD be used for tasks with a single correct answer?
ADHD is not designed for that; it focuses on open-ended problems where multiple viable solutions exist.
What recent integrations has Cognition AI announced?
Cognition recently acquired The Interaction Company (makers of Poke) and TierZero, integrating their automations into Devin.
Is Devin available for federal use?
Yes, Devin is now FedRAMP High In-Process, enabling its use for U.S. federal government applications.
